Ormiston Park Academy in South Ockendon seeks a highly motivated Science teacher to join our dedicated team. This position is ideal for both newly qualified and experienced teachers who wish to make a positive impact on student outcomes. As a valued member of our expanding Science department, you will enjoy excellent professional development opportunities and become part of a supportive school community focused on achieving the highest standards for our students.

How to prepare for a job interview at Ormiston Park Academy

Know Your Science Inside Out

Make sure you brush up on your subject knowledge. Be prepared to discuss key concepts and recent developments in science education. This will show your passion for the subject and your commitment to inspiring students.

Showcase Your Teaching Style

Think about how you can demonstrate your teaching methods during the interview. Prepare examples of engaging lessons you've delivered or innovative strategies you've used to help students grasp complex topics. This will highlight your ability to make a positive impact on student outcomes.

Connect with the School's Values

Research Ormiston Park Academy’s ethos and values. Be ready to explain how your teaching philosophy aligns with their mission to achieve high standards. This connection will show that you're not just looking for any job, but that you're genuinely interested in contributing to their community.

Prepare Thoughtful Questions

At the end of the interview, you'll likely have the chance to ask questions. Prepare thoughtful ones that reflect your interest in professional development opportunities and the support available for teachers. This shows that you’re serious about growing in your role and making a lasting impact.
